## Support

The stringsweep script extracts translatable strings from the Lark mobile and web codebases and writes them to the shared catalog. Run it as part of every release cut; skipping it causes untranslated strings to ship. Common failures: malformed interpolation placeholders, duplicate keys across modules, and stale catalog locks from aborted runs. The script prints actionable errors for each case. If extraction fails in a way the error output does not explain, contact the localization tooling team before proceeding with the release.

escalation mailbox, bafog-fafog: ulador@paliqlabs.internal

**Vendor note: Inkmill markdown pipeline**

Rendering for Parchway docs is outsourced to Inkmill under an annual contract, renewing each March. They handle sanitization and PDF export; we own the upload queue. SLA: 4-hour response on rendering failures. Escalate only after two failed retries. Their support desk is reachable at the address below.

billing contact of hahaf-baguf = zorael.tammir.jorius@sivrelhq.internal

Handover note — Crumbwheel order cutoffs.

Welcome aboard. The bakery cutoff rule in Crumbwheel closes same-day orders at 14:00 local to each storefront, not UTC — this has bitten us twice. Holiday overrides live in the calendar service and take precedence silently, so always check there first when a cutoff looks wrong. To unlock the calendar service's admin console after a restart, enter the recovery passphrase below.

vault phrase of bagap-bahaf = silion-pelox-sorox-casdor-quenwyn-fraax-eliox-praael-kelion-quenvan-kasox-rusael-norius-belvan

Subject: Deep-link cut-over done — heads up

Hey support crew,

We flipped mobile deep-link routing from the old Linkhopper service to the new Waymark router last night. Short version: links now resolve through Waymark first, with Linkhopper as fallback until Friday. If customers report links opening the web view instead of the app, tag the ticket "waymark-routing" so Priya's team sees it. The current routing config values are listed below for quick reference.

deployment values, yadug-bawif:
[framir]
team = pelox
access_code = ac_a38ab2
owner = tamion.julael
host = framir.tolvaqlabs.test
port = 11211
peer = tammir.zemvargrid.local
salt = 2215ef03
pin = 1541